Journal Entry 1 by Kaija from Solomon, Kansas USA on Wednesday, November 12, 2003
I read this while waiting for a table at the Olive Garden.. I loved it so much that I was reading at the table.. and finished not long after getting home. The next day the movie came out.. and I went to see it. The book is SO much better! The book has much more about the each individual person in the hospital.. Explains what is wrong with many of them and what brought them on... but it is a very ambiguous ending. It never reaches a full conclusion about what in fact he is.. I think the truth lies in the middle.. I don't want to say my theory (and my friends also) because it may spoil it for anyone who hasn't read it. This one is on relay!

Journal Entry 3 by wingcestmoiwing from Hamilton, Ontario Canada on Saturday, February 14, 2004
Received in the mail yesterday and read today!
I was amazed at how close the movie stuck to the novel, except for Brewer's children. Of course, one downside is that I could only picture Jeff Bridges and Kevin Spacey and not think of the characters as anyone else. But I was impressed. Since seeing the movie, I had my own theory of who Prot was and what happened to Bess and the novel just reaffirmed that theory. Very imaginative novel full of humour, quiet wisdom and spirituality.
